Lot description: Roman Provincial CILICIA, Germanicopolis. Hadrian. AD 117-138. Æ (24mm, 8.21 g, 5h). Laureate, draped, and cuirassed bust right / Zeus standing left, holding patera and scepter; eagle at feet to left. SNG France 756 (same dies); SNG Levante 573; SNG von Aulock 6791 (same dies). Near VF, grayish-green patina, rough surfaces. Rare mint. From the R. D. Frederick Collection. Estimate: $200 | ![]() |
